Hanson & Doremus Investment Management Increases Holdings in Visa Inc. (NYSE:V)

Hanson & Doremus Investment Management increased its stake in Visa Inc. (NYSE:VFree Report) by 0.7%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 15,036 shares of the credit-card processor’s stock after acquiring an additional 100 shares during the period. Visa makes up approximately 0.8% of Hanson & Doremus Investment Management’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 24th biggest position. Hanson & Doremus Investment Management’s holdings in Visa were worth $3,390,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Visa Trading Up 1.3 %

V opened at $237.48 on Friday. The company has a current ratio of 1.50, a quick ratio of 1.50 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.56. The firm has a market cap of $444.88 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 31.75, a PEG ratio of 1.79 and a beta of 0.97. Visa Inc. has a 12 month low of $174.60 and a 12 month high of $238.28. The stock has a fifty day moving average price of $228.31 and a 200-day moving average price of $223.87.

Visa (NYSE:VFree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, April 25th. The credit-card processor reported $2.09 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.97 by $0.12. Visa had a net margin of 50.95% and a return on equity of 50.21%. The business had revenue of $7.99 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$7.79 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$1.79 earnings per share. The firm’s revenue was up 11.1%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Visa Inc. will post 8.58 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Visa Profile

(Free Report)

Visa Inc operates as a payments technology company worldwide. The company operates VisaNet, a transaction processing network that enables authorization, clearing, and settlement of payment transactions. It also offers credit, debit, and prepaid card products; tap to pay, tokenization, click to pay; Visa Direct, a real-time payments network; Visa B2B Connect, a multilateral B2B cross-border payments network; Visa Treasury as a Service, a cross-border consumer payments business; and Visa DPS that provides a range of value added services, including fraud mitigation, dispute management, data analytics, campaign management, a suite of digital solutions, and contact center services.
